  • BURGHen Boy Likes this wine: 94 points

    February 4, 2023 - This one seemed like it had the whole package. Most notable was the balance from 1st sip through to finish. It was so elegant with the right touch fruit, wood, depth and acidity It had a multitude of flavors that meshed/integrated beautifully. Pear, citrus, oak, stone.

  • BornToRhone Likes this wine: 93 points

    November 28, 2022 - 750 ml; PnP; Robust nose of apple and lemon; bold but not over the top flavors of apple, pear, lemon curd, slight vanilla, very slightly yeasty. Very enjoyable new world chardonnay. Sadly, this is my last 2016 Golden Slope. Drinking very well now and will likely last another 3-5 yrs easily. This wine is a true bargain.

  • Mbad77 wrote: 92 points

    October 8, 2022 - Last bottle was 2 years ago and my comments were it was a little burly around edges and needed to settle down. It has done that and burly is replaced by a slightly sappy finsih with acid cutting through a bit more.
    Very solid

  • Lfholland Likes this wine:

    September 10, 2022 - Tried this a couple of years ago and thought the oak was a little too prominent. Much better spot today for my tastes as the acidity shines through a little more providing balance and verve.

    Very floral on the nose with some citrus and lactic notes too.

    Full bodied on the palate with citrus notes, Asian pear, and tropical fruit notes throughout. Peppery acidity really kicks in on a long finish.

  • Margaux Bro Likes this wine: 93 points

    August 15, 2022 - In a nice spot. Drink now or hold
